Specifications

The Thermo Fisher Scientific Sil Tubing 2.06mm Id 50ft/pk 95590-42 comes with a precise 2.06mm inner diameter (ID) and is supplied in a 50-foot length. This specific ID is crucial for applications requiring controlled fluid transfer, especially when dealing with low volumes or high precision demands, such as in analytical instrumentation or pharmaceutical research. The tubing is constructed from platinum-cured silicone, a material known for its exceptional purity, inertness, and resistance to a wide range of chemicals and extreme temperatures.

This platinum-curing process is a significant advantage over peroxide-cured silicones, as it minimizes the risk of extractables and leachables, making it ideal for sensitive biological or chemical applications. The 50-foot pack size is generous for many lab setups, offering enough material for multiple runs or extensive systems without needing frequent replacements. Its Shore A durometer rating typically falls between 50-60, providing a good balance of flexibility and resilience, essential for peristaltic pump applications where repeated compression and release occur.

Accessories and Customization Options

This product is a length of tubing, so it doesn’t come with accessories in the traditional sense. However, its utility is often enhanced by barbed fittings, connectors, and hose clamps that are readily available from Thermo Fisher Scientific and other laboratory suppliers. The 2.06mm ID dictates the size of these associated components; using fittings that are too large or too small will compromise the seal and potentially lead to leaks or inefficient flow.

While the tubing itself is not customizable in terms of color or printed markings, its compatibility with a vast array of standard laboratory fluid handling components makes it highly adaptable. This broad compatibility ensures it can be integrated into a wide spectrum of existing or custom-built systems.
